Brakes make use of rubbing to bring a vehicle to a total stop. This rubbing develops a significant quantity of warm that can degrade the brakes and brake elements over time.
Brake inspections are important to ensuring safe driving conditions. Determining when to look for an evaluation will depend upon your driving problems and choices. The objective of our brake assessment is to locate, detect, and go over any issues while suggesting brake repair treatments. Throughout a brake examination, we might find that your brake system needs brand-new brake pads or shoes, or the installation of new brake calipers or wheel cyndrical tubes. The brake master cylinder and Antilock Braking System (ABS) actuator make the liquid pressure that makes points happen. From there, a collection of tubes and lines move that stress to the brake calipers (which you can see through the wheels of many cars). From there, a piston in the caliper presses against the brae pad, and the friction product on the pad contacts the blades surface area to turn the kinetic energy of motion into warmth power and quit the automobile.
Brake liquid is where everything starts (to stop?). Brake liquid is a specific liquid and should never ever have oil or any kind of other fluid contributed to it. Brake fluid is hydroscopic, which implies it brings in wetness from the environment. The only thing Memphis has even more of than traffic is moisture! Brake liquid should be changed when it transforms to a darker color, and on the timetable that Nissan sets for your cars and truck (usually 15,000 to 30,000 miles).

When you purchase a new brake pad, it has a common density of around 8 to 12 mm or concerning a fifty percent inch. Over time, your car's brake pad will deteriorate. A brake pad at 3 mm or around one tenth of an inch will take about 40,000 miles of driving to entirely put on out.
Maybe a foreign item such as a small stone or road debris. It can also be a signal that your brake-pads are wearing and require changing. As brake pads put on littles steel in your brake pad come in call with the blades to create a squealing sound when you apply the brakes.
Brake blades are large, flawlessly round, smooth metal discs that sit within the wheels. When the disc has actually become askew or unevenly worn it will certainly vibrate or totter when you struck the brakes. Left irregular, the product will continue to improve the unequal places, making the problem even worse gradually.
Too hot brakes cause a recognizable burning chemical odor. Draw over to a safe area and enable the brakes to cool down.
